Practical Functionality for Everyday Residents
The mechanism behind Miami Dade Crime Stoppers Seeks Public Help to Catch Fugitives is designed to be straightforward and accessible. Citizens who observe relevant information can submit tips through designated channels. These channels often include phone lines, mobile applications, and secure online forms. Personal information is protected to encourage more residents to come forward. Law enforcement reviews the submitted information and investigates credible leads. Successful tips may result in rewards based on case-specific criteria. This structure allows communities to support justice efforts in a confidential and low-pressure way.
Common Questions About Public Involvement Programs
How does submitting a tip protect my identity?
The system is built with privacy as a core principle. Tipsters can remain anonymous by using unique identifiers or encrypted channels. No personal details are shared with law enforcement without explicit consent. This confidentiality encourages broader participation from concerned citizens.
What kind of information is useful to law enforcement?
Useful tips generally include specific locations, vehicle descriptions, or behavioral patterns. Vague statements are less actionable than detailed observations. Information that helps narrow a search area significantly increases the chances of a positive outcome. Even seemingly small details can be valuable in certain investigations.
Are there rewards for successful tips?
Some cases offer monetary rewards when information leads to an arrest or prosecution. The amount depends on the case and specific program guidelines. Not every submission results in compensation, but all contribute to public safety. The reward structure is designed to motivate helpful information sharing.

Addressing Common Misunderstandings
A frequent misconception is that these programs encourage vigilantism or personal intervention. In reality, they are designed solely for information gathering. Citizens are never expected to confront suspects or engage directly. Another myth is that only serious crimes are relevant to tips. Even minor observations can be crucial when connected to larger investigations. Clear communication helps align public understanding with actual program goals. Education plays a key role in dispelling fear-based narratives.
